What Is a good carpentry job?
Asked by mike
I'm 16 years old and I'm starting to look into a future career I go to school for construction (carpentry, plumbing, hvac, welding, electrical) and I really enjoy the carpentry part. So I'm asking where do you suggest a good high paying carpentry job. Ex: union, school board, etc. Also could someone explain what exactly is the carpenters union. Thanks
A:
Best Answer:
The carpenters union could be good depending on where you live.I spent 30 years as a carpenter and its good at first and you can make good $.But after a while it takes it tole on your body.If you like building stay in school and go for being a superintendent.Or get a contractors lic or maby drafting school.If you need to be on the site building though try finish work. also I would like to tell you there could be allot of time you will be out of work.
I have helped build half the housing devolpments in san diego
